A judge presiding above a case may perhaps initiate investigations on relevant matters, but frequently judges would not have the ability to conduct investigations for other branches or organizations of government.
In certain establishing international locations quite a few judges at all levels have tiny formal legal instruction. Often They may be religious authorities as opposed to lawyers, given that in many countries faith and secular federal government are certainly not sharply differentiated, and the regulation derives from religious doctrine. The vast majority of nations that use lay judges at the bottom trial degree, nonetheless, insist upon professionally educated judges in trial courts of typical jurisdiction As well as in appellate courts.
There may be appreciable diversity in the way lay judges are picked out and Utilized in judicial perform. In America, one example is, lay lawyer judges are popularly elected for confined conditions, While in England earn they are appointed by a Judicial Appointments Fee (topic to acceptance with the lord chancellor) to provide right up until retirement or removing. In England lay judges provide intermittently in panels with a rotating foundation for brief periods, whereas in The us they sit by itself and constantly. In South Africa lay judges (referred to as assessors) often sit with Expert judges; in England they often do; and in America they never ever do.
